Crown Prince of Fujairah witnesses opening of Fujairah Media Forum; honours leading Arabic newspapers

FUJAIRAH: H.H. Sheikh Mohammed bin Hamad bin Mohammed Al Sharqi, Crown Prince of Fujairah, has affirmed the role of media in the development of societies and shaping the awareness of individuals.

He pointed out the attention given by the Fujairah government, in implementation of the directives of H.H. Sheikh Hamad bin Mohammed Al Sharqi, Supreme Council Member and Ruler of Fujairah, to develop the media sector and focus on its tools to keep pace with global changes on all levels.

This came as he attended the opening of the Fujairah Media Forum 2024, titled ‘Parallel Media’ in the presence of Sheikh Dr. Rashid bin Hamad Al-Sharqi, Chairman of the Fujairah Authority for Culture and Information, and Saeed AlEter. Chairman of UAE Government Media Office, with the participation of a select group of Arab media professionals, publishers, and avid followers of modern media issues.

Mohammed Saeed Al Dhanhani, Director of the Fujairah Emiri Diwan, and Chairman of the Higher Committee of the Forum, in his speech on b
ehalf of the Fujairah government, affirmed that the credit for the return of the Fujairah Media Forum this year goes to the directives of His Highness the Ruler of Fujairah, who attaches great importance to media, and to the support and diligent follow-up of His Highness the Crown Prince of Fujairah, to keep up with the developments in modern media for the higher good of the nation and society.

Al Dhanhani stated that the Fujairah Media Forum is discussing important issues related to culture, education, and media under the theme ‘Parallel Media’. The goal is to enhance traditional media and effectively use digital media for societal benefit. He raised the question of ‘how to utilise technology without losing sight of our core objectives. The focus is on maintaining serious media’s impact in addressing significant issues and preventing distractions from its main purpose.’

Al Dhanhan emphasised the importance of working collectively to uphold cultural identity and deliver the right messages using technology,
as media plays a crucial role in achieving these objectives and shaping future generations.

The Crown Prince of Fujairah honoured some of the oldest Arabic newspapers, represented by their editors-in-chief: Maged Monir, Editor-in-Chief of Egypt’s Al-Ahram; Hamad Al Kaabi, Editor-in-Chief of UAE’s Al-Ittihad; and Ibrahim al Mulaifi, Editor-in-Chief of Al Arabi magazine.

The opening ceremony featured a short film titled “A World of Magic,” showcasing the evolution of media worldwide. It highlighted technological advancements in recent years and the emergence of new electronic platforms, and their impact on traditional media. Prior to honouring the prestigious newspapers, a film was shown documenting their media experiences and histories.

The ceremony was attended by Dr. Ahmed Hamdan Al Zeyoudi, Director of the Office of H.H. Crown Prince of Fujairah, and a diverse audience of media professionals.
